About M. S. Osofsky
M. S. Osofsky is a scholar working on Condensed Matter Physics,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ials,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ics, Materials Chemistry and Geophysics, having authored 139 papers that have together received 3.9k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Physics of Superconductivity and Magnetism (81 papers), Magnetic and transport properties of perovskites and related materials (41 papers), Advanced Condensed Matter Physics (31 papers), Magnetic properties of thin films (24 papers), ZnO doping and properties (19 papers), Superconductivity in MgB2 and Alloys (14 papers), Superconducting Materials and Applications (13 papers) and Quantum and electron transport phenomena (11 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Condensed Matter Physics (2.0k citations),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ials (2.4k citations),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ics (1.3k citations), Materials Chemistry (1.6k citations) and Electrical and Electronic Engineering (610 citations). M. S. Osofsky has collaborated with scholars based in United States, France and Russia. Frequent co-authors include R. J. Soulen, B. Nadgorny, P. R. Broussard, T. Ambrose, J. M. Byers, Shuo Cheng, C. T. Tanaka, J. M. D. Coey, A. Barry and Janusz Nowak. Their work appears in journals such as Physical review. B, Condensed matter, Applied Physics Letters, Physica C Superconductivity, Journal of Applied Physics and IEEE Transactions on Applied Superconductivity.
